Ambapat - Khalwa, Khandwa (East Nimar)
Ambapat is a village situated in the Khalwa tehsil of Khandwa (East Nimar) district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 10 km from the tehsil headquarters in Khalwa and around 66 km from the district headquarters in Khandwa. Dakochi serves as the Gram Panchayat for Ambapat village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Ambapat is 505594. The village covers a total geographical area of 326.24 hectares and falls under the 450001 pincode. Khandwa is the nearest town, located about 66 km away.
Ambapat village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Harsud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Betul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Ambapat
According to the 2011 Census, Ambapat village had a total population of 937 people, including 470 males and 467 females, living in 146 households. The sex ratio was 994 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 34.48%, with male literacy at 43.82% and female literacy at 25.47%. The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 934.
The table below presents a detailed demographic breakdown of the village, including separate male and female figures for each population category.
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 937 | 470 | 467 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 212 | 114 | 98 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 934 | 468 | 466 |
| Literate Population | 250 | 156 | 94 |
| Illiterate Population | 687 | 314 | 373 |

Transport and Connectivity of Ambapat
Ambapat is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Khandwa to Ambapat is about 66 km, with a usual travel time of around ~1.9 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
